Output 57edf8f7bfc762985e2d330e1fc94cdeeee66abd1e8cef23bc016dcb6812de3d:0

value
30434164
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3771b5f3ea017962cf3b640dd7aae82e9b7b0 OP_EQUAL
address
3BMEXwzGA2MyKPadVAKQe8fFX2CAptznwp
transaction
57edf8f7bfc762985e2d330e1fc94cdeeee66abd1e8cef23bc016dcb6812de3d
spent
true